Berrange Date: Thu, 29 Mar 2012 09:41:37 +0000 (+0100) Subject: Fix format specifiers in test cases on Win32 X-Git-Tag: v0.9.12-rc1~138 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=f48de0f161348d0b47743e1411796d4e40160546;p=thirdparty%2Flibvirt.git Fix format specifiers in test cases on Win32 Some of the test suites use fprintf with format specifiers that are not supported on Win32 and are not fixed by gnulib. The mingw32 compiler also has trouble detecting ssize_t correctly, complaining that 'ssize_t' does not match 'signed size_t' (which it expects for %zd). Force the cast to size_t to avoid this problem * tests/testutils.c, tests/testutils.h: Fix printf annotation on virTestResult. Use virVasprintf instead of vfprintf * tests/virhashtest.c: Use VIR_WARN instead of fprintf(stderr). Cast to size_t to avoid mingw32 compiler bug Signed-off-by: Daniel P.
